A cyclist comes to a skidding stop in `10m`. During this process, the force on the cycle due to the road is `200N` and is directly opposite to the motion.
a. How much work does the road do on the cycle?
b. How much work does the cycle do on the road?

A

`+ 200 J`

B

` - 200 J`

C

zero

D

`- 20,000 J`

Text Solution

Verified by Experts

The correct Answer is:
C

Here, work is done by the frictional force on the cycle and is equal to `200 xx 10 = - 2000 J`
As the road is not moving, hence, work done by the cycle on the road = zero.
